Practical Tips for Cutting Machines and Merchandise
For those using Cricut or Silhouette machines, font choice can make or break a project. Intricate fonts often result in weeding nightmares, where tiny pieces of vinyl stick to the mat instead of the transfer tape. Orchis Prima is a dream to cut. Its solid strokes and lack of unnecessary flourishes mean that each letter cuts cleanly and weeds easily. This makes it ideal for producing custom stickers, shirt decals, and mug wraps. When working with Fonts for physical merchandise, durability and ease of application are key, and this typeface delivers on both fronts.
Before selling any physical products made with Orchis Prima, always double-check your commercial licensing terms. Ensure that your license covers the specific items you are creating, whether they are physical goods like t-shirts or digital templates. Additionally, consider how the font pairs with other elements. While Orchis Prima stands strong on its own, combining it with a complementary serif or a bold display font can add depth to your designs.
